RenameIt 项目使用教程
1. 项目的目录结构及介绍
RenameIt 项目的目录结构遵循典型的开源项目布局,主要包含以下几个部分:
- src: 源代码目录,包含项目的主要代码文件。
- docs: 文档目录,包含项目的相关文档,如用户手册、开发指南等。
- tests: 测试目录,包含项目的单元测试和集成测试代码。
- config: 配置文件目录,包含项目的配置文件。
- scripts: 脚本目录,包含项目运行和部署所需的脚本文件。
每个目录下通常会有一个 README.md
文件,用于介绍该目录的内容和使用方法。
2. 项目的启动文件介绍
RenameIt 项目的启动文件通常位于 src
目录下,文件名为 main.py
或 app.py
。该文件主要负责以下功能:
- 初始化项目配置。
- 加载必要的模块和插件。
- 启动主程序循环。
启动文件的代码结构如下:
import config
from modules import *
def main():
# 初始化配置
config.init()
# 加载模块
load_modules()
# 启动主程序
start_app()
if __name__ == "__main__":
main()
3. 项目的配置文件介绍
RenameIt 项目的配置文件通常位于 config
目录下,文件名为 config.yaml
或 config.json
。配置文件主要包含以下内容:
- 基本配置: 如项目名称、版本号等。
- 日志配置: 如日志级别、日志文件路径等。
- 数据库配置: 如数据库连接字符串、数据库类型等。
- 其他配置: 如第三方服务配置、缓存配置等。
配置文件的示例如下:
project:
name: RenameIt
version: 1.0.0
logging:
level: INFO
file: logs/renameit.log
database:
type: sqlite
connection_string: db/renameit.db
services:
api_key: YOUR_API_KEY
endpoint: https://api.example.com
以上是 RenameIt 项目的基本使用教程,涵盖了项目的目录结构、启动文件和配置文件的介绍。希望这些内容能帮助你更好地理解和使用该项目。